About This Colorado Facility
Axis Health System - Crossroads at Grandview in Durango, Colorado, is an addiction treatment facility specializing in opioid addiction, drug addiction, and substance abuse. They provide a full range of services, including residential care, detox, inpatient levels of care, and aftercare support. Mental health and dual diagnosis services are also offered to meet the needs of individuals seeking treatment for substance abuse. As a member of the Axis Health System, patients in the Durango location are part of an extensive network of care and treatment services throughout the state.
At Axis Health System - Crossroads at Grandview, quality care is provided by a team of professionals, including licensed and certified counselors and other experts in the field of addiction and substance abuse. Services are tailored to meet the individual needs of patients and include a range of evidence-based treatments, such as individual and group counseling, family therapy, and trauma-informed care. Their staff is committed to providing comprehensive, quality care that is designed to help individuals in their recovery journey. The facility is accredited by the Joint Commission and is licensed by the State of Colorado Department of Human Services.

Opioid addiction treatment helps people addicted to opioids in Colorado curb their drug use. The selection of a treatment setting depends on the severity of the addiction. Mild cases are usually treated in outpatient facilities; severe cases need hospitalization or treatment in a residential facility. Doctors use medicines along with counseling and behavioral therapies to treat the addiction. The treatment includes medication, counseling and therapy. It can also include group counseling, individual counseling and family counseling.

Detox is a drug rehab process that begins before the actual drug rehab treatment. It is used to remove any residual toxins left in your body (and brain) after using drugs, and it is used with the intent to help you or your loved one complete drug rehab.
If you are addicted to opiates like heroin, methadone, or prescription painkillers, you will detox with medication. This is because the withdrawal symptoms are often more intense and uncomfortable for an opiate addict than for someone who has abused or is dependent on other drugs, like cocaine.
Inpatient programs are intensive regimes that require individuals suffering from serious addictions to admit themselves into a controlled environment. Inpatient programs in Colorado generally span over 28 days to six months. The first step in an inpatient program is medically assisted detox. Doctors and addiction specialists at Axis Health System - Crossroads at Grandview monitor the individual’s vital signs as the drugs leave their system. Some inpatient rehab programs also provide counseling for family members to provide encouragement and emotional support. In inpatient programs, patients have access to 24-hour medical supervision.
Residential treatment programs are those that offer housing and meals in addition to substance abuse treatment. Rehab facilities that offer residential treatment allow patients to focus solely on recovery, in an environment totally separate from their lives. Some rehab centers specialize in short-term residential treatment (a few days to a week or two), while others solely provide treatment on a long-term basis (several weeks to months). Some offer both, and tailor treatment to the patient’s individual requirements.
Aftercare comprises services that help recovering addicts readjust to normal day-to-day Colorado activities. It can last a year or even longer. Services include individual and family counseling, medications to reduce cravings, and treatment of psychiatric and other medical conditions. Aftercare support begins once you have completed earlier stages of treatment.

Durango, Colorado Addiction Information
The Centennial State has slipped to a ranking of 12th in the country for drug abuse. Each year around 24% of the state's population uses illegal drugs while nearly 5% of its population abuses alcohol. Substance-related deaths in Colorado were responsible for 15.12% between 2008 and 2017. Fortunately, Colorado drug and alcohol addiction treatment are available to help a person overcome addiction.
In 2013, 1,743 people were living in Durango who was dependent on or abusing drugs. Additionally, in 2013 there were 682 admissions to treatment centers for drug abuse in the Durango area. In Durango, there are 4 addiction treatment centers. A few different drug treatment options are available in Durango, Colorado. The most common type of drug rehab is an inpatient facility.
